Nice thread -

There are obviously going to be numerous opinions on what is considered a "rare" song and what isn't.. What I want to bring up is the rarity of a song off of an album like "The Circle," let's choose "Learn To Love;" now the album is only about a year-and-a-half old, and the boys have been touring since "The Circle" came out, however placing into perspective the fact that irregardless, the album hasn't been out that long; there are other songs from WAY older albums that haven't been played much, or at all...

Let's now choose the song "Stick To Your Guns" from "New Jersey." We're talking over 20-years since this album was released and the song has only been played what, a couple of times? I love this song; I would obviously consider it a rarity.. Even more of a a rarity over "Learn To Love," which hasn't even been played at all.

Understand where I am trying to go with this? Just one point of many that can be presented.

Do you define a rarity as a song that either A.) hasn't ever been played regardless of how long it's been out? B.) a song that hasn't been played much (a few times), if at all on a Jovi album over five-years old? Or a certain length of your choosing? C.) .... Your definition.

I look forward to seeing what others have to bring to the table in terms of their definition of a "rarity."
